Output 08868dd2a94ae3d00094042afcf2484069c8b9373bd0c6cb9dae9287bd11c27f:2

value
3158720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7cf1281b77cee522c9c978623ed41581d38305e OP_EQUAL
address
3GzJqDPqXTYMCvHWUAKp81Z4UJqzwQtyYA
transaction
08868dd2a94ae3d00094042afcf2484069c8b9373bd0c6cb9dae9287bd11c27f
spent
true